> Booting with initcall_debug I see this with current Linux next:
>
> ...
> [ 1.697313] cpuidle: using governor menu
> [ 1.701353] initcall init_menu+0x0/0xc returned 0 after 0 usecs
> [ 1.707458] calling gpmc_init+0x0/0x10 @ 1
> [ 1.711784] initcall gpmc_init+0x0/0x10 returned 0 after 0 usecs
> [ 1.717974] calling omap3_l3_init+0x0/0x10 @ 1
> [ 1.722653] initcall omap3_l3_init+0x0/0x10 returned 0 after 0 usecs
> [ 1.729201] calling omap_l3_init+0x0/0x10 @ 1
> [ 1.733791] initcall omap_l3_init+0x0/0x10 returned 0 after 0 usecs
> [ 1.740314] calling gate_vma_init+0x0/0x70 @ 1
> [ 1.744976] initcall gate_vma_init+0x0/0x70 returned 0 after 0 usecs
> [ 1.751522] calling customize_machine+0x0/0x30 @ 1
> [ 3.823114] initcall customize_machine+0x0/0x30 returned 0 after 2011718 usecs
> [ 3.830566] calling init_atags_procfs+0x0/0xec @ 1
> [ 3.835583] No ATAGs?
And the long time above with customize_machine() ends up being
pdata_quirks_init() calling of_platform_populate().
> Laurent & Tomi, care to check what you guys see in the slow booting case
> after booting with initcall_debug?
But maybe the long delay is something else for you guys so please check.
